Sadieville Statistics Back to top
  • Population (2000): 2,674
  • Land Area (2000): 183.484 square kilometers
  • Water Area (2000): 0.097 square kilometers

Houses (2000): 1,041
Sadieville Population - Urban/Rural
Urban/Rural Population Percent
Color 0 Box Urban 0 0.00%
Color 1 Box Rural, Farm 243 9.08%
Color 2 Box Rural, Non-farm 2,433 90.92%
